Taking concrete steps towards greater LGBT+ inclusivity is a key part of fostering diverse and welcoming scientific workplaces.
Last year in the Exploring the Workplace for LGBT+ Physical Scientists report, we found that although the workplace climate is generally improving, more action is needed to build genuine LGBT+ inclusivity in the physical sciences. Differences in experience are particularly stark for some in the community, such as trans and non-binary scientists. From this data and further research, we've created a set of resources that tackle the key issues faced by LGBT+ physical scientists.
